Tuesday, 17 September 2019

Easiest way to upload a image to a folder with node?

Currently taking a image from a form type="file" and trying to put it in a folder on the server. I am currently using multer but instead of getting the images I get [these really weird unusable files]( https://imgur.com/a/NShMj33 ).This is what the post route and multer reference look like:​const upload = multer({dest: __dirname + '/assets/img/'});app.post('/sign-up', upload.single('image'), (req, res) => {console.log(req.body);const user = {email: req.body.email,password: req.body.password,f_name: req.body.fName,l_name: req.body.lName,user_img: req.body.image,description: req.body.description,comment_quote: req.body.cQoute,blog_quote: req.body.bQoute};const sql = 'INSERT INTO users set ?';const query = db.query(sql, user, (err, result) => {if (err) throw err;console.log(result);res.send('New user created');});});

Submitted September 17, 2019 at 02:37PM by nikulasoskarsson

No comments:

Post a Comment